- The distance between Encarnacion, Paraguay and Hilo, (Big Island), Hawaii, Hawaii is approximately 11,868 km or 7,375 mi.
- To reach Encarnacion in this distance one would set out from Hilo, (Big Island), Hawaii bearing 113.6°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Encarnacion bearing 104° or ESE .
- Encarnacion has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Hilo, (Big Island), Hawaii has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Encarnacion is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Hilo, (Big Island), Hawaii is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 2.9 °C (5.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.8 °C (14°F) more in Encarnacion.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1521.8 mm (59.9 in) less which is equivalent to 1521.8 l/m² (37.35 US gal/ft²) or 15,218,000 l/ha (1,626,905 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.4° lower in Encarnacion than in Hilo, (Big Island), Hawaii.
- Relative humidity levels are 5%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 1.8°C (3.2°F) lower.
